- Language: React Native uses JavaScript; Xamarin uses C#.
- Performance: Xamarin delivers closer-to-native performance; React Native is highly efficient for most use cases.
- Learning Curve: React Native suits web developers; Xamarin fits .NET developers.
- Code Reusability: React Native shares 95%+ code; Xamarin shares 75-90% depending on platform-specific features.
- Community: React Native has a larger, more active open-source community; Xamarin has dedicated enterprise support.
- Cost: React Native is generally more budget-friendly for startups; Xamarin suits enterprises seeking long-term stability.
Choose React Native if: You need rapid prototyping, cost efficiency, and access to a thriving community. Perfect for mobile-first startups and consumer applications.
Choose Xamarin if: You require seamless integration with Microsoft services, enterprise-grade performance, or your team has C# expertise. Excellent for business-critical and complex applications.
